Answer:
A. The car travels the same distance per unit of time because the portion shows a linear, increasing function.
Step-by-step explanation:
The portion of the graph labelled I is linear increasing function. So, the slope is constant. The slope is the the ratio of change in the quantity of y-axis to that of x-axis.
Here distance is plotted in the y-axis and time in the x-axis.
So, the slope here is Distance covered/ Time, which is nothing but the speed of the car.
Since the slope is constant, the car is travelling at a constant speed in the portion of the graph labelled I, which means, the car travels the same distance per unit of time in the portion I.
